The Ishihara test is a color perception test for red-greencolordeficiencies. The test consists of a number of coloredplates,called Ishihara plates, each of which contains a circle ofdotsappearing randomized in color and size.Within the pattern aredotswhich form a number or shape clearly visible to those withnormalcolor vision, and invisible, or difficult to see, to thosewith ared-green color vision defect, or the other way around. Thefulltest consists of 38 plates, but the existence of a deficiencyisusually clear after a few plates. But this test consisting only17plates.

The most common cause of color blindnessisdueto a fault in the development of one or more of the threesetsofcolor sensing cones in the eye. Males are more likely tobecolorblind than females as the genes responsible for themostcommonforms of color blindness are on the X chromosome. Asfemaleshavetwo X chromosomes, a defect in one is typicallycompensatedfor bythe other, while males only have one X chromosome.Colorblindnesscan also result from physical or chemical damage totheeye, opticnerve, or parts of the brain. Diagnosis istypicallywith theIshihara color test; however a number of othertestingmethods alsoexist.[2]There is no cure for color blindness.[2] Diagnosis mayallowaperson's teacher to change their method of teachingtoaccommodatethe decreased ability to recognize color.[1]Speciallenses mayhelp people with red-green color blindness whenunderbrightconditions. There are also mobile apps that canhelppeopleidentify colors.[2]Red-green color blindness is the most common form,followedbyblue-yellow color blindness and total colorblindness.Red-greencolor blindness affects up to 8% of males and0.5% offemales ofNorthern European descent. The ability to seecolor alsodecreasesin old age.[2] Being color blind may makepeopleineligible forcertain jobs in certain countries. This mayincludepilot, traindriver, and armed forces. The effect of colorblindnesson artisticability, however, is controversial. The abilityto drawappears tobe unchanged and a number of famous artists arebelievedto havebeen color blindColor vision deficiencies can be classified asacquiredorinherited.Deuteranopia is a type of color vision deficiency wherethegreenphotoreceptors are absent. It affects hue discriminationinthe sameway as protanopia, but without the dimming effect.Likeprotanopia,it is hereditary, sex-linked, and found in about 1%ofthe malepopulation.[6]Protanomaly is a mild color vision defect in whichanalteredspectral sensitivity of red retinal receptors (closertogreenreceptor response) results in poor red–greenhuediscrimination. Itis hereditary, sex-linked, and present in 1%ofmales. Thedifference with protanopia is that in this casetheL-cone ispresent but malfunctioning, whereas in the earliertheL-cone iscompletely missing.[7]
